Do I need Home Warranty Insurance?
Publish Date: June 1, 2005

If a dwelling was erected or alterations or additions carried out on the property within the last six years at a cost in excess of $12,000.00(current as at 1 April 2005) -

  1. by a Licensed builder/tradesman you should have been provided with a Certificate of Home Warranty Insurance
  2. by you as Owner/Builder you must obtain Home Warranty Insurance prior to entering into a Contract to sell the property

You can be fined should you fail to comply with this Act.

There are some conditions and exemptions.
